The Signaling and Traffic Engineering development kits as described in
MARBEN™ GMPLS Suite are very flexible, and can be used to accommodate a wide range of MPLS, OIF or GMPLS-based applications. However, they require a significant development effort from the
MARBEN™ Products customer to build a complete application on top of these development kits.
The
MARBEN™ GMPLS controllers are a set of high-level libraries built on top of the Signaling and Traffic Engineering development kits. Such controllers are intended for
MARBEN™ Products customers that are willing to trade off some flexibility against faster GMPLS application development and integration. These controllers provide GMPLS and GMPLS-based (OIF/ITU-T UNI and E-NNI) signaling and routing procedures.
It consists of three different controllers:
- the Signaling controller
- mainly manages Setup and teardown of calls and connections. It invokes services from the Routing Controller and the Link Resource manager to achieve such a goal.
- the Routing controller
- mainly manages Path computation capabilities using the traffic engineering information running IS-IS or OSPF routing protocols.
- the Link resource manager
- performs local TE-Links management.
